ATLANTIC COAST

Share
From the Associated Press

* at No. 7 Boston College 55, Bowling Green 24: Matt Ryan threw four touchdown passes, and the Eagles (6-0) made four interceptions late in the first half to overwhelm the Falcons (3-2) and get off to their best start in 65 years. Boston College scored 38 consecutive points after Tyler Sheehan’s six-yard pass to Freddie Barnes with 8:55 left in the half cut the Eagles’ lead to 14-10. Less than seven minutes later, it was 38-10 as the Falcons’ pass-happy offense backfired when the Eagles picked off four passes in the last six minutes of the half.

* No. 15 Virginia Tech 41, at No. 22 Clemson 23: Victor Harris had a record-tying 100-yard kickoff return and Eddie Royal returned a punt 82 yards for another score to lead the Hokies (5-1, 2-0) over the Tigers (4-2, 2-2) at Clemson, S.C. D.J. Parker had a 32-yard interception return for a touchdown on Clemson’s first series, and the Hokies held Clemson without a first down for nearly 21 minutes.

* at North Carolina 33, Miami 27: Brandon Tate scored on a long end-around in a spurt of 27 points to start the game, and Connor Barth kicked four field goals to lead the Tar Heels (2-4, 1-2) over the Hurricanes (4-2, 1-1) at Chapel Hill, giving Coach Butch Davis a victory against his former program. Darnell Jenkins had a 97-yard touchdown catch, the second-longest play in school history, for Miami.

* at Maryland 28, Georgia Tech 26: In the first start of his career, Chris Turner threw for 255 yards, and Lance Ball ran for three touchdowns to lead the Terrapins (4-2, 1-1) over the Yellow Jackets (3-3, 1-3) at College Park. Travis Bell sent a 52-yard field-goal attempt wide right with 54 seconds left.

* Wake Forest 41, at Duke 36: Receiver Kenneth Moore rushed for two touchdowns, and the Demon Deacons (3-2, 2-1) withstood Thaddeus Lewis’ four-touchdown performance to beat the Blue Devils (1-5, 0-3) at Durham, N.C. Moore caught 11 passes for 100 yards and rushed four times for 84 yards, with scoring runs covering 21 and 53 yards.

* at Florida State 27, North Carolina State 10: Michael Ray Garvin’s 43-yard interception return for a touchdown broke a tie and sparked the Seminoles (4-1, 1-1) over the Wolfpack (1-5, 0-3) at Tallahassee. Xavier Lee, making his first start of the season, completed 16 of 28 passes for 257 yards.

* Virginia 23, at Middle Tennessee 21: Chris Gould kicked a 34-yard field goal with eight seconds left, redeeming himself after an earlier extra-point miss, and the Cavaliers (5-1) defeated the Blue Raiders (1-5) at Murfreesboro.
